kylejack Posted October 20, 2011 Share Posted October 20, 2011 he new building funded by the Khalifa bin Zayed Al Nahyan Charity Foundation will land instead on a different demo site: the southeast corner of Moursund St. and M.D. Anderson Blvd., a 5-acre lot which until last year was the home of the UT Health Science Center’s Mental Science Institute. M.D. Anderson bought the 2-story concrete-and-brick building at 1300 Moursund from its sister institution, then had it torn down over the summer, identifying the land at the time only as a location for “future expansion.”http://swamplot.com/where-m-d-anderson-will-put-the-uae-presidents-new-building/2011-01-20/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
